Season
Aug 16–Sep 30: artificials only on general-law streams. This is fly water by state rule. Special laws still override. Confirm FLOAT / the law book. Official rule
License
Maine freshwater license; Maine saltwater registry
Park
City of Augusta hard ramp. Toilets. Trailer parking. Signed public waterfront.
Walk in
Short from the waterfront lot.
Wading
Big river. Shore fly.
Usual window
Spring through the fly-only date. Stripers on the tide in season.
